Understanding Legal AI Tools
Legal AI tools are software solutions that use artificial intelligence to assist legal professionals in different aspects of their work. These tools can analyze vast amounts of data, perform legal research, and even predict outcomes based on historical cases. By automating routine tasks, AI allows lawyers to focus more on strategic thinking and client interaction.

Document Review and Management
One of the most significant applications of AI in law is document review and management. Legal professionals often deal with massive volumes of documents, and manually reviewing them can be time-consuming and prone to error. AI-powered tools can quickly scan and analyze documents, identifying relevant information and flagging potential issues.
This not only speeds up the process but also improves accuracy, ensuring that no crucial detail is overlooked. As a result, legal teams can handle larger caseloads with greater efficiency.
Enhancing Legal Research
Legal research is another area where AI tools shine. Traditional research methods are labor-intensive, requiring hours of sifting through case laws and statutes. AI-powered research tools can perform these tasks in a fraction of the time, providing legal professionals with quick access to relevant case laws, precedents, and legal opinions.

Predictive Analytics
Predictive analytics is transforming how lawyers approach case strategy. By analyzing data from past cases, AI tools can predict the likely outcomes of current cases. This insight helps legal teams develop more informed strategies, offering clients a better understanding of potential results and risks.
Predictive analytics also aids in settlement negotiations, as lawyers can present data-backed predictions to support their positions.
Improving Client Interaction
AI tools are enhancing client interaction by providing more personalized and efficient services. Chatbots and virtual assistants can handle routine inquiries, schedule appointments, and provide updates on case progress. This allows legal professionals to focus on more complex client needs, improving overall client satisfaction.

Ethical Considerations
While AI tools offer numerous benefits, they also raise ethical considerations. Issues such as data privacy, algorithmic bias, and the potential for over-reliance on AI must be carefully managed. Legal professionals must ensure that AI tools are used responsibly and that human oversight remains a critical component of the decision-making process.
